Abstract

A control device for controlling a front wheel drive force and a rear wheel drive force of a vehicle that includes a transmission comprises: a first controller for controlling a drive force of a main drive wheel and a drive force of an auxiliary drive wheel, the drive force of the main drive wheel being one of the front-wheel drive force and the rear-wheel drive force, and the drive force of the auxiliary drive wheel being another of the front-wheel drive force and the rear-wheel drive force; and a second controller for detecting whether a speed-change ratio of the transmission has changed. In a case that the second controller has detected that the speed-change ratio has changed, the first controller increases the drive force of the auxiliary drive wheel and reduces the drive force of the main drive wheel.
